As most of you know, I have modded V6's since around 1997,
but I have never owned a V6 Mustang... until now!
Got the "project" for $1K and got it down here yesterday,
it's a 95- 5 speed with lots of mods including a blown HG!
1995 V6, bone stock internal engine...
External performance mods are as follows:
Pacesetter crossover, true duals, 2.25"
MAC stainless muffs
3.73's, T-Lok, 7.5" rear
MAC Cold Air Intake
The prior owner (my friend, PilotMulvs) ran a 15.4 in this setup,
it's mostly cuz he is a great driver at the track! The reason I'm
getting this for a great price is that I've known Pilot since 1998
and he is buds with my son also, who is now 17 and needs a car

Thanks everyone for the encouragement, we will get it running soon
and probably if the 3.8 has good pistons, we will BV the heads, cam it,
and heavily port the intakes. I have an extra-short runner upper 1/2
done that will support a 65 MM TB and runner lengths will match a BIG
cam (for a 3.8) so expect some good numbers for an NA stock shortblock...
It will also have as much compression as I can get w/o new pistons.
